Pampilhosa da Serra has different pollen seasons. Trees, grasses, and weeds release pollen. This happens when plants make seeds. It usually starts in spring.
The olive tree pollen season starts in March. It can last until May. Many people stay inside when pollen counts are high. They close windows and doors.
Grasses release pollen in late spring and early summer. Weeds release pollen in late summer and autumn. Pollen counts can be high on warm and sunny days.
The pollen season ends in autumn. The air is cleaner then. People can go outside without worrying about pollen. Winter has low pollen counts.

Annual Pollen Overview
Check out this month-by-month overview of the daily average pollen count in Pampilhosa da Serra 🌾. This data is based on previous years and serves as a guideline to help you understand when different pollen seasons typically occur in your city.
Alder | Birch | Grass | Mugwort | Olive | Ragweed |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Jan | 15.4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Feb | 7.8 | 0 | 0.7 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Mar | 0.1 | 13 | 11.6 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Apr | 0 | 18.9 | 130.9 | 0 | 130.4 | 0 |
May | 0 | 0.8 | 421.2 | 0 | 480.2 | 0 |
Jun | 0 | 0 | 300.5 | 0 | 60.6 | 0 |
Jul | 0 | 0 | 110.3 | 0 | 1 | 0 |
Aug | 0 | 0 | 35.5 | 0.6 | 0 | 0.1 |
Sep | 0 | 0 | 6.5 | 0.2 | 0 | 1.1 |
Oct |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0.1 | 0 | 0 |
Nov |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1.2 | 0 | 0 |
Dec |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
